We are looking for you to join our team as a Sensors Systems Engineering Manager 2 based out of Woodland Hills, CA. Our success is grounded in our ability to embrace change, move quickly and continuously drive innovation. The successful candidate will be collaborative, open, transparent, and team-oriented with a focus on team empowerment & shared responsibility, flexibility, continuous learning, and a culture of automation. This is a fully onsite position located in Woodland Hills, CA working a 9/80 schedule.

What You'll get to Do:

  • Manage/Oversee a team of Sensor Engineers working the engineering design, development, and transition to production of inertial navigation systems

  • Develop and implement strong processes with emphasis on quantitative management and continuous improvement

  • Provide management guidance to achieve outstanding cost, schedule and technical performance

  • Responsible for technical guidance and oversight in developing technical and cost proposals

  • Interface with business facing leads to coordinate staffing requirements and ensure proper skill mix to support program activities

  • Mentor and challenge team members to develop skills and provide career planning/development paths

  • Responsible for all manager related activities to include, but not limited to: Conduct performance and salary reviews, approve timecards, performance management, and work closely with HR on elevated employee matters

  • Other duties as assigned

Basic Qualifications Sensors Systems Engineering Manager 2:

  • Bachelor's degree in Science, Technology, Engineering, or Mathematics (STEM; or related discipline with 8years of relevant experience; Master's degree with6 years of relevant experience.

  • Experience in development of advanced sensors for aerospace and/or defense applications

  • Experience leading a team on a technical development effort or technical production support

  • Understanding of Systems Engineering or project management tools such as DOORS, MS Project, etc.

  • Experience with Systems Engineering processes, procedures, and best practices

  • Experience with generating and/or reviewing cost estimates/basis of estimates (BOEs)

  • The ability to obtain and maintain a U.S. Government Secret clearance is required within a timeframe set forth by management

  • Must be able to work full-time onsite in Woodland Hills, CA.

Preferred Qualifications Sensors Systems Engineering Manager 2:

  • Master's Degree in a technical field with 6 years of experience in a multi-disciplined engineering environment or PHD with 3 years of experience

  • Development and implementation of processes to ensure product development efficiency and accuracy

  • Experience in inertial sensor development, fiber optics, ring laser gyros, and sensor electronics

  • A proven track record of leading a team of engineers and of establishing strong relationships with other functional organizations and Program Offices

  • Experienced with Product Lifecycle Management (PLM) tools, such as Siemens Teamcenter Enterprise

  • Experienced with failure analysis techniques and methods (RCCAs)

  • Technical project management with budget/EVMS experience

  • Experience with Model Based Systems Engineering (MBSE)

  • Experience authoring and reviewing technical proposals

  • Experience with engineering planning, scheduling, metrics, earned value systems, and workload forecasting

  • Active DoD Secret clearance
